The Building Performance Contractors Assn has offered to weatherize a home in Greenburgh this summer for free. Weatherization will help the homeowner be more comfortable, save on energy costs, and help the environment. If you or someone you know would like this free work done, please contact Paul Feiner or Greenburgh’s Energy Conservation Coordinator Allegra Dengler at 993-1649.

The work would include an energy audit, then airsealing, insulation and boiler tune-up, and possibly some other donated products or services. To be eligible, the house should be in need of energy improvements. They are seeking a homeowner that needs the help, such as a senior citizen struggling with bills and a cold house, or a family with a spouse serving in Iraq struggling to make ends meet. The work project would be publicized to interest others in the benefits of weatherization. Please e mail adengler@greenburghny.com

Saturday, April 17 from 9am - 11am || Stretch 'n' Stroll | Andrus Children's Center, Yonkers http://www.andruschildren.org/
“In a joint effort with our campus Health Center, we invite you to ‘shake off’ the winter and enjoy a healthy morning outdoors and a chance to tour the beautiful 110-acre Dyckman Family Farm, now the Andrus Children’s Center. The morning includes a non-competitive stroll (or run if you would like) along campus paths, optional quiet contemplation at our new Labyrinth, stretching exercises on our 20-station fitness trail, and a final stretch in a yoga session for kids or adults. Friends will have the chance to come behind our walls and explore our campus which some of the children we serve call “home” and learn about Andrus. This relaxed morning is perfect for all ages.”
